dc.description.abstractOxidation behavior of a refractory AlNbTiVZr0.25 high-entropy alloy at 600-900 °C was investigated. The oxidation mechanisms operating at different temperatures were discussed and a comparison of oxidation characteristics with the other alloys was conducted-
